The Benefits of a Portfolio Management System

A portfolio management system (PMS) is a software application used by investment professionals to make better-informed decisions about investments. A PMS allows users to track, manage and analyze their portfolios in one place. It also provides tools and features that can help users make more informed investment decisions.

There are many benefits of using a PMS, including:

  1. Improved decision-making: A PMS gives users access to data and analytics that can help them make more informed investment decisions. With a PMS, users can track their portfolios, see how their investments are performing, and find new opportunities. 
  2. Greater transparency: A PMS provides greater transparency into the inner workings of an investment firm. This can help investors understand how their money is being managed and where it is going.
  3. Better communication: A PMS can improve communication between an investor and their investment manager. With a PMS, investors can see what their managers are doing with their money and provide feedback on performance.
  4. Lower costs: A PMS can help reduce the costs of investing by automating some of the processes involved in managing a portfolio. For example, a PMS can automate the process of buying and selling securities, which can save time and money.

How to Choose the Right Portfolio Management System

There is no one-size-fits-all answer to the question of how to choose the right portfolio management system. The best approach is to evaluate your needs and then select a system that will address those needs.

Some factors you may want to consider when choosing a portfolio management system include:

  • Ease of use: How easy is the system to use? Can you easily navigate it and find the information you need?
  • Features: What features does the system have? Does it have all the features you need?
  • Pricing: How much does the system cost? Is it within your budget?
  • Security: How secure is the system? Does it have robust security measures in place to protect your data?
